Subject: Tidewatch widget handoff

Team — effective Monday, ownership of the Tidewatch tide-table widget moves off my plate. Open items: the DST offset bug and the harbor-selector refresh. Docs are current in the Marlowe wiki. Please route all widget questions and review requests going forward to the new owner named below.

approver of bagug-kadug = Belox Julir Aldael Praix

Received last Tuesday. Key points: three-year exclusive distribution in the Velmore region, minimum volume commitments, co-branded Fennick line. Pricing acceptable; exclusivity clause is not. Counterproposal drafted — non-exclusive, two-year term, review at month 18. Legal has flagged the indemnity language as one-sided; revision requested. Hartwyn wants signature within thirty days. Recommend we hold firm on exclusivity and let the deadline slip if needed. The strategic rationale behind this position is set out confidentially below.

confidential, yahip-hagug: Gorixax Logistics plans to lower the Ulaael list price by 26.6 percent in October. The pricing group signed off on a budget of $199.9 million for Project Holix. The renewal with Kasdorox Systems closes at $137.5 million a year, 8.2 percent above the last contract. Project Lamion slips by a full year because of the audit delay.

The garage occupancy feed for the Brindlewood campus arrives over a message queue every thirty seconds, one record per level, published by the Stallgrid edge boxes. Counts can briefly go negative when a sensor double-fires on exit; the ingest job clamps these to zero and flags the interval. If the feed stalls for more than five minutes, the dashboard falls back to the last known snapshot. Sensor mappings, queue names, and the replay procedure are documented on the internal page below.

runbook for tahog-kadug: https://gitlab.qirvanworks.corp/projects/pages/view/b139298aed28

Re: load test harness for the Cartwheel checkout flow — the scenario mix looks reasonable, but the ramp profile is too aggressive for what we see in production on the Moorfield cluster. Real traffic climbs over roughly ten minutes during the Brightloom flash sales, not thirty seconds, so the current ramp will trip the circuit breakers before we learn anything useful. Please align the harness with the agreed tuning constants, which I've listed below.

tuning constants:
QUOTAS = {
    "druwyn": 5,
    "holix": 5,
    "zorath": 5,
    "holwyn": 10,
}